The Oakland Golden Grizzlies and Syracuse Orange meet Tuesday in college basketball action at the JMA Wireless Dome. The Oakland Golden Grizzlies look for their third win. The Syracuse Orange look to get above a .500 record. 

The Oakland Golden Grizzlies are averaging 75.6 points on 44 percent shooting and allowing 80 points on 47.2 percent shooting. Trey Townsend is averaging 16.1 points and 7.1 rebounds, while Keaton Hervey is averaging 14.4 points and 7.9 rebounds. Jalen Moore is the third double-digit scorer and Blake Lampman is grabbing 3.1 rebounds. The Oakland Golden Grizzlies are shooting 33 percent from beyond the arc and 73.7 percent from the free throw line. The Oakland Golden Grizzlies are allowing 36.8 percent shooting from deep and are grabbing 29.1 rebounds per game.

The Syracuse Orange are averaging 69.4 points on 43.6 percent shooting and allowing 69.3 points on 40 percent shooting. Jesse Edwards is averaging 14.8 points and 11.6 rebounds, while Judah Mintz is averaging 14.4 points and 3 assists. Joseph Girard III is the third double-digit scorer and Chris Bell is dishing 0.4 assists. The Syracuse Orange are shooting 30.6 percent from beyond the arc and 71 percent from the free throw line. The Syracuse Orange are allowing 34.6 percent shooting from deep and are grabbing 33.3 rebounds per game.

The Golden Grizzlies are 1-11 ATS in their last 12 road games and 6-20 ATS in their last 26 games overall. The Orange are 2-5 ATS in their last 7 home games and 1-4 ATS in their last 5 games overall. The over is 7-2 in Golden Grizzlies last 9 overall. The under is 4-0 in Orange last 4 overall.
